Situated in a quiet cul-de-sac, this property is only a few hundred yards from the centre of Coniston village. Here you will find a good selection of shops, cafes and pubs including a popular inn, which serves hearty meals and its own micro brewed ales. Very popular among walkers, the local area encompasses some fantastic routes, from the nine mile trek through the Grizedale Forest to the challenging climb to the top of Coniston Old Man. Alternatively, why not explore the area from the water by hiring a canoe, rowing boat or small motor boat from nearby Coniston Boating Centre.

Step through the entrance hall and into the bright and airy lounge. With comfortable sofas, a well-stocked bookcase, cosy gas fire and French doors opening onto the decked terrace, this is a fantastic room all year round. The kitchen is spacious and light with a sociable breakfast bar, ample surface space and modern appliances. Once prepared, enjoy family meals in the adjoining dining room, which again opens onto the decked terrace through French doors, generating an al fresco feel come rain or shine. A laundry room and shower room are also located on the ground floor, while the bedrooms and bathroom are upstairs. One double, two twins (in the larger twin room the two divan beds and can be pushed together to make a king size bed on request at time of booking) and one bunkroom, all of the bedrooms are light and airy with plenty of storage space for making yourself at home.

Outside a wide decked terrace spans the length of the house, offering plenty of space for al fresco dining. A large lawn beyond is ideal for children to play and also makes a great picnic spot in the summer.
